TROUBLESHOOTING
Trouble Probable Cause Remedy
Troubleshooting Dispensing System
WATER-TO-CONCENTRATE
“RATIO”TOO LOW OR TOO HIGH.
• Dispensing valve concentrate
flow regulator not properly
adjusted.
• Adjust Water-to-Concentrate
“Ratio” as instructed.
• CO
2 gas pressure to concen-
trate pumps insufficient to
operate pumps.
Adjust concentrate pumps CO2
regulator as instructed.
ADJUSTMENT OF DISPENSING
VALVE CONCENTRATE FLOW REG-
ULATOR DOES NOT INCREASE TO
DESIRED WATER-TO-CONCEN-
TRATERATIO.
No concentrate supply. Replenish concentrate supply
as instructed.
• Concentrate supply container
not securely connected into
concentrate system.
• Securely connect concentrate
supply container into concen-
trate system.
Concentrate pumps CO
2 reg-
ulator out of adjustment.
Adjust concentrate pumps CO2
regulator as instructed.
Dispensing valve syrup flow
regulator, syrup tank quick
disconnect, or syrup line
restricted.
Sanitize syrup system as
instructed.
Improper Baume of concen-
trate.
Replace concentrate supply.
Dirty or inoperative concen-
trate flow regulator.
Disassemble and clean dis-
pensing valve concentrate flow
regulator.
Tapered plastic washer inside
tube swivel nut connection
distorted from being over
tightened restricting concen-
trate flow.
Replace plastic washer. Make
sure it seats properly.
ADJUSTMENT OF DISPENSING
VALVE CONCENTRATE REGULA-
TOR DOES NOT DECREASE TO
DESIRED WATER-TO-CONCEN-
TRATERATIO.
Dirty or inoperative concen-
trate flow regulator.
Disassemble and clean dis-
pensing valve concentrate flow
regulator.
NO PRODUCT DISPENSED.
Dispensing valves keyed lock-
out switch in “OFF” position.
Place keyed lock-out switch in
“ON” position.
No electrical power to Unit. Plug in Unit power cord or
check for blown fuse or tripped
circuit breaker.
• Disconnected dispensing
valve power cord.
Connect dispensing valves
power cord.
Disconnected or broken wir-
ing to dispensing valves.
Connect or replace wiring.
• Inoperative transformer or
dispensing valve solenoids.
Replace inoperative part.
ONLY CONCENTRATE DISPENSED.
Water inlet supply line shutoff
valve closed.
Open water inlet supply line
shutoff valve.
